there is really no magic to get good clients who want the job done and are happy to pay.
No magic at all.
But there's a right way to do it and a way to screw it up - as usual.
This is what you do:
• Having a quality flyer or leaflet that will get people to contact you to request a quote. I have an example of a flyer that works well for you. And 'in my manual' How to set up and manage a successful business painting and decorating '. All you have to do is to enter the data in the appropriate places and have it printed or print it yourself on a computer printer. Alternatively, get a good copy and go to your local photocopy shop. You should be able to get 1000 printed out for less than £ 25.00. Not a bad deal at all. Your first job should pay for it easily.
• Get it reliably distributed and for the right areas. With 'To the right areas "intend through the boxes of letters of the houses where people live who actually have the money to pay for your services. These people are: homeowners, at work, Living on the streets where other owners dwelling how to take care of their properties.
• Place an ad in your local directory Thompson. and 'premises, it is read, and you should get the business. you should expect to pay around £ 150 - £ 0,00 for a simple ad box. You can check this out with your local representative for Thompson. It 'also much cheaper than Yellow Pages (where your advertisement can get' drowned 'by everyone else) and, in my opinion, proportionally better value for money.
• With time, you can easily get a small website that promotes your services and contains images of work has been completed, contact details etc.
• When people respond to your flyer, or your advertising make sure they get a good response from you or who answers the phone. Courtesy is important. Be careful to get their: phone number, address, full name, and set a time to see them you will notice obviously down and repeat them so you know you've got it right.
• When people call you to ask for a quote, make an appointment to see them within 48 hours. You want to appear interested, but not desperate. (Even if you are desperate!).
• Turn up at the agreed time.
